What is the relationship between alteryx and "commitment" to a Database?

dgaines1972
7 - Meteor

I have a workflow that writes a single record to an oracle database.  This is about 6 seconds.  Within oracle, an internal procedure is triggered by this record having been added.  It takes about 20 min for this procedure to complete within Oracle.   I am finding that the alteryx workflow then continues to clock until that internal procedure within the database has completed.  This causes the overall run time to include that extra 20 min.  

 

Q1-Why does this happen?  

Q2-Is there anything I can do to make the Alteryx faster, or clock only the actual 6 seconds?
